Is there a specific ball joint for the left and right side of a Mazda Protege?

as far as i know, almost every car is

Mazda Protege Ball Joints

I finally found the answer to my own question so if anyone else needs to know, for this specific year of the Mazda protege, ball joints ARE interchangeable.